Now when this song kicks in at the 7 second mark (after a nice opening), it is then just an onslaught of a quality track, pushing you to the limit (if on the dance floor).  A nice relentless synth and drum rhythm, with a cool distorted vocal going on in the background, which I think might be something to do with police calls communications.  This works really effectively over the pounding musical beat.  The music actually partially makes me think of U2 in parts.

There are a couple of nice musical breaks in the track which are very effective, where the male voice comes in, and then the pace kicks in again.

As someone mentioned, and I agree, this would be a qulaity entry on the new Mission: Impossible 3 soundtrack.
